The Long Range Discrimination Radar (LRDR) is officially operational and ready to defend the U.S. homeland. As the backbone of the Missile Defense Agency’s layered defense strategy, LRDR provides unmatched long-range precision to detect and track ballistic missile threats, ensuring the effectiveness of ground-based interceptors.
Built on advanced solid-state, gallium nitride (GaN) technology and an open-architecture platform, LRDR leverages decades of U.S. investment in radar and missile defense systems, including the Aegis Combat System, 兔子先生 Fence, and Aegis Ashore. Its proven algorithms and scalable design keep pace with evolving threats while supporting both homeland defense and 兔子先生 Force operations.
With LRDR now operational, the U.S. has a critical, forward-looking capability that strengthens national security and reinforces deterrence against modern missile threats.
